Abstract

Systems and methods are provided for treating clothing with a clothing treatment device under a pressure environment altered from an ambient pressure. In one example, the clothing treatment device may comprise a chamber which may be evacuated to a low internal air pressure by a vacuum pump and/or a cold plate, wherein fabric articles placed inside the chamber may be washed and dried, and wherein the drying occurs under low pressure conditions within the chamber via one or more heat sources. In at least one example, the fabric articles may be hanging within the chamber.

Claims

1 . A clothing treatment device, comprising:
 a chamber;   a vacuum seal for the chamber holding an air pressure within the chamber at a different pressure than an ambient pressure outside the chamber;   a vacuum pump in fluid communication with the chamber; and   a controller to operate the vacuum pump to change the air pressure within the chamber to be different than the ambient pressure outside of the chamber during operation of the clothing treatment device.   
     
     
         2 . The clothing treatment device of  claim 1 , wherein the clothing treatment device is a dryer, and wherein the pressure within the chamber is reduced relative to the ambient pressure outside of the chamber during a drying cycle while operating the clothing treatment device. 
     
     
         3 . The clothing treatment device of  claim 2 , further comprising one or more article hangers inside the chamber for hanging articles during the drying cycle while the clothing treatment device is operated. 
     
     
         4 . The clothing treatment device of  claim 2 , wherein the chamber is a rotating drum for tumbling articles during the drying cycle while the clothing treatment device is operated. 
     
     
         5 . The clothing treatment device of  claim 2 , wherein the clothing treatment device is additionally a washer, and wherein the pressure within the chamber is increased relative to the ambient pressure outside of the chamber during a washing cycle while operating the clothing treatment device. 
     
     
         6 . The clothing treatment device of  claim 5 , further comprising one or more article hangers inside the chamber for hanging articles during the washing cycle while the clothing treatment device is operated. 
     
     
         7 . The clothing treatment device of  claim 5 , wherein the chamber is a rotating drum for tumbling articles during the washing cycle while the clothing treatment device is operated. 
     
     
         8 . The clothing treatment device of  claim 5 , further comprising introducing water into the chamber during the washing cycle. 
     
     
         9 . The clothing treatment device of  claim 1 , wherein the clothing treatment device is a washer, and wherein the pressure within the chamber is increased relative to the ambient pressure outside of the chamber during a washing cycle while operating the clothing treatment device. 
     
     
         10 . The clothing treatment device of  claim 9 , further comprising one or more article hangers inside the chamber for hanging articles during the washing cycle while the clothing treatment device is operated. 
     
     
         11 . The clothing treatment device of  claim 10 , wherein one or more washing agents are introduced into the chamber during the washing cycle. 
     
     
         12 . A method for treating clothing, comprising:
 positioning one or more fabric articles in a chamber in a hanging configuration;   flowing air through the chamber; and   applying heat to the chamber.   
     
     
         13 . The method of  claim 12 , further comprising
 condensing gaseous moisture inside the chamber on a cold plate during a treatment cycle; and   extracting gases from the chamber during the treatment cycle.   
     
     
         14 . The method of  claim 12 , further comprising reducing an internal gas pressure in the chamber responsive to determining that a moisture level in the chamber is greater than a threshold moisture level during the treatment cycle. 
     
     
         15 . The method of  claim 12 , where the treatment cycle is determined to be complete responsive to the moisture level in the chamber being less than the threshold moisture level. 
     
     
         16 . The method of  claim 12 , further comprising washing the one or more fabric articles in the hanging configuration. 
     
     
         17 . A method for treating clothing comprising:
 sealing a chamber;   determining a moisture level in the chamber;   determining a pressure level in the chamber; and   adjusting the pressure level in the chamber to a preselected pressure level responsive to the determined moisture level in the chamber being greater than a threshold moisture level.   
     
     
         18 . The method of  claim 17 , wherein the preselected pressure level is a reduced pressure level compared to an ambient pressure outside of the chamber. 
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 18 , wherein the pressure level is reduced by pumping air out of the chamber via a vacuum pump. 
     
     
         20 . The method of  claim 19 , further comprising heating the chamber and tumbling the clothing in the chamber.
